Family-Friendly Itinerary for Andaman Nicobar

Friday, August 18: Arrival in Port Blair

Start your Andaman Nicobar adventure by arriving in Port Blair, the capital city. In the morning, visit the Cellular Jail National Memorial to learn about India's freedom struggle. Afterward, head to Corbyn's Cove Beach for a relaxing afternoon by the sea. In the evening, explore the local markets and indulge in delicious seafood.

  • Cellular Jail National Memorial: Cost - Free, Time - 2 hours
  • Corbyn's Cove Beach: Cost - Free, Time - 3 hours
  • Local Markets: Cost - Varies, Time - 1 hour
Saturday, August 19: Havelock Island

Take a morning ferry to Havelock Island, known for its pristine beaches. Spend the morning at Radhanagar Beach, often ranked among the best beaches in Asia. After lunch, visit the Elephant Beach for snorkeling and spotting vibrant marine life. Enjoy the evening at leisure.

  • Radhanagar Beach: Cost - Free, Time - 4 hours
  • Elephant Beach: Cost - Ferry ticket, Snorkeling - INR 1,000 per person, Time - 3 hours
Sunday, August 20: Neil Island

Embark on a day trip to Neil Island, a paradise for beach lovers. Begin your day by visiting Bharatpur Beach, famous for its coral reefs and clear waters. In the afternoon, explore the natural rock formation at Natural Bridge. Conclude the day by witnessing a mesmerizing sunset at Laxmanpur Beach.

  • Bharatpur Beach: Cost - Free, Time - 3 hours
  • Natural Bridge: Cost - Free, Time - 1 hour
  • Laxmanpur Beach: Cost - Free, Time - 2 hours
Monday, August 21: Port Blair - Ross Island

In the morning, visit Ross Island, also known as the "Paris of the East." Explore the remnants of British architecture and lush greenery on this uninhabited island. Afterward, return to Port Blair and visit the Anthropological Museum to learn about the indigenous tribes of the Andaman and Nicobar Islands.

  • Ross Island: Cost - Ferry ticket, Entry fee - INR 30 per person, Time - 4 hours
  • Anthropological Museum: Cost - Entry fee - INR 10 per person, Time - 2 hours
Tuesday, August 22: Baratang Island

Embark on an exciting day trip to Baratang Island, known for its limestone caves and mangrove forests. Start your day by visiting the awe-inspiring limestone caves. In the afternoon, take a boat ride through the dense mangrove creeks to witness the vibrant ecosystem. Return to Port Blair in the evening.

  • Limestone Caves: Cost - Entry fee - INR 50 per person, Time - 2 hours
  • Mangrove Creek Boat Ride: Cost - Boat ticket - INR 1,500 per person, Time - 3 hours
Wednesday, August 23: Jolly Buoy Island

Enjoy a day of snorkeling and swimming at Jolly Buoy Island, part of the Mahatma Gandhi Marine National Park. Explore the colorful coral reefs and diverse marine life. Pack a picnic lunch to savor on the pristine beach. Return to Port Blair in the evening.

  • Jolly Buoy Island: Cost - Ferry ticket, Snorkeling - INR 500 per person, Time - 6 hours
Thursday, August 24: Port Blair - Departure

Spend your last morning in Port Blair by visiting the Samudrika Naval Marine Museum, where you can learn about the region's marine ecosystem. Afterward, stroll along Marina Park and enjoy beautiful views of the sea. Depart from Port Blair with unforgettable memories of Andaman Nicobar.

  • Samudrika Naval Marine Museum: Cost - Entry fee - INR 50 per person, Time - 2 hours
  • Marina Park: Cost - Free, Time - 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ique experience, consider visiting the lesser-known North Bay Island, famous for its underwater sea walk and glass-bottom boat rides. Another hidden gem is the Chidiya Tapu, where you can witness stunning sunsets and spot a variety of bird species. These attractions provide a serene and nature-filled experience that the whole family will enjoy.
